Meet the Desert Iguana
Desert iguanas are these rad reptiles that call the hot, arid deserts of the southwestern United States home. We’re talking places like the Mojave and Sonoran deserts. These lizards are built to handle the heat, with light-colored scales that reflect sunlight and keep them from overheating.
Habitat Hangouts
These iguanas love chilling in sandy areas with sparse vegetation. They often hang out in creosote bushes and rocky crevices, where they can easily hide from predators. You’ll usually spot them basking in the sun or scurrying around looking for food.
What’s on the Menu?
Desert iguanas are mainly herbivores. They munch on leaves, flowers, and fruits. They have a particular fondness for the yellow flowers of the creosote bush. But they aren’t too picky and will eat other plants they come across. Sometimes, they might even snack on insects if they’re feeling adventurous.
Cool Traits and Behaviors
Desert iguanas are not just any lizards. They’re super fast runners, able to dart across the hot sand at impressive speeds. This helps them escape from predators like hawks and snakes. They also have this cool ability to regulate their body temperature. When it gets too hot, they burrow into the cool sand to avoid overheating.
